
Alan MacGibbon
Alan MacGibbon is the former Chair of the Board at Toronto-Dominion Bank (TD), where he played a pivotal role in overseeing the bank's governance and strategic direction. His leadership coincided with significant growth for TD, but he also faced challenges related to regulatory issues that affected the bank's operations, leading to his early resignation alongside the CEO.
